Why are cockroaches so common in Dubai?

Dubai offers the best conditions for cockroaches to thrive all year round. The warm climate of the city, readily available water and food, and urban infrastructure create an ideal environment where these pests can spread quickly when left untreated.

Reasons why cockroaches are so commonly found in Dubai

  • Hot climate of Dubai

Warm temperatures in Dubai keep the cockroaches active all through the year, enabling them to continuously breed without any seasonal slowdown.

  • Humid bathrooms and kitchens

Condensation, leaking pipes and damp areas in the kitchen, laundry and bathrooms provide moisture to cockroaches, needed for survival.

  • Improper sanitation and food waste

Grease, food crumbs, pet food, unclean surfaces and overflowing bins attract cockroaches and enable them to multiply.

  • Drainage systems and construction sites

Sewers, construction zones and drainage systems provide breeding spaces and shelter. Cockroaches also migrate to nearby buildings during construction activities.

  • Potent breeding conditions all year round

Without a cold season, cockroaches continuously reproduce. Prompt treatment and early prevention are key for avoiding large infestations.

Common Types of Cockroaches Found in Dubai

Many species of cockroach are found across Dubai, each having distinct characteristics and preferred habitats. Identifying the species can help determine the most effective prevention strategy and treatment.

  • German cockroach

German cockroach is one of the most common species found indoors in Dubai. It is tan to light brown in color with two dark stripes behind the head measuring around 1.1 to 1.6 cm in length. Such cockroaches typically hide behind appliances, in the kitchen, near food preparation areas, and inside cabinets. They reproduce rapidly and often stay hidden in cracks as well as crevices, making them one of the hardest species to eliminate without any professional treatment.

  • American cockroach

The American cockroach is one of the largest species found in Dubai, growing up to 5 cm long. It is pale-yellow and reddish-brown and has a pale-yellow mark behind its head. It prefers damp and warm areas to thrive, like drainage systems, basements, and sewers. It can easily enter homes through plumbing lines, drains, and gaps under cracks in walls and doors. American cockroaches can contaminate surfaces and food with bacteria, posing potential health risks.

  • Oriental cockroach

Oriental cockroaches are dark brown to black in color with a shiny appearance. They thrive in damp, cool environments and are found commonly around basements, drains, utility rooms, outdoor water sources, and bathrooms. Their preference for moist areas makes them a frequent problem in buildings with poor drainage and plumbing leaks.

  • Brown-banded cockroach

Brown-banded cockroaches are smaller than most of the common species, measuring around 1 cm to 1.4 cm. They are light brown in color with distinctive bands across their abdomen and wings. Unlike other cockroaches, they prefer warm and dry areas and are often found in cupboards, wardrobes, furniture, and electronic devices. Their ability to infest areas beyond bathrooms and kitchens makes them particularly challenging to detect.

Life cycle of cockroaches

Cockroaches undergo three stages of life – egg, nymph and adult. Their high reproduction rate and short breeding cycle enable infestations to rapidly grow in Dubai’s climate.

  • Eggs

Female cockroaches produce egg capsules called ootheca, each containing various eggs. Depending on the species, a single egg holds up to 16 eggs to 50 eggs, and a female can produce several egg cases during her lifetime. Such capsules are often hidden in crevices, cracks, and other protected areas.

  • Nymph

Once the eggs hatch, young cockroaches come out as nymphs. They resemble adults but are smaller and wingless. Nymphs shed their exoskeletons several times as they grow. They feed on organic matter and scraps before maturing.

  • Adult

Adult cockroaches are completely developed, and they start reproducing soon after reaching maturity under favorable conditions. They can live for several months and continue producing multiple generations.

Because they remain hidden and reproduce quickly, a small number of cockroaches can develop into a massive infestation in just a short period of time if not properly treated.

How are cockroaches dangerous?

Of course they are. Cockroaches can contaminate food and spread germs and negatively affect both mental and physical well-being.

Learn more about:

  • Psychological impact

A cockroach infestation can also cause anxiety, stress, and sleep disturbances. Frequent sightings often leave residents concerned about hygiene, marking early treatment crucial.

  • Health risks

Cockroaches contaminate food as well as kitchen surfaces with bacteria picked up from garbage, drains, and other unsanitary areas. They may carry pathogens like E.coli and Salmonella; shed skin and saliva can worsen asthma and trigger allergies.

What attracts cockroaches?

Cockroaches are constantly searching for water, food, and safe places for hiding. Removing such attractants can significantly reduce the infestation risk, like:

  • Food – Leftovers, crumbs, spilled drinks, and uncovered food
  • Water – Damp sinks, leaking pipes, standing water, and condensation
  • Clutter – Unused items, stacks of paper, and storage areas are great hiding spots
  • Shelter – Crevices, cracks, undisturbed dark places, and cabinets are great shelters.
  • Garbage – Uncovered or overflowing bins are easy-to-access food sources.
  • Pet food – Food bowls left out overnight can attract cockroaches.
  • Cardboard boxes – Cardboard provides both surface and shelter for cockroaches to lay and hide eggs.
  • Grease – Kitchen surfaces, greasy stovetops and exhaust areas attract pests.

Prevent cockroach infestation with the following steps

Preventing cockroach infestation needs a blend of regular maintenance, good hygiene, and proactive pest management. The following simple measures can help in keeping offices and homes cockroach-free:

  • Keep your kitchens clean – Immediately clean up spills, wipe countertops, and do not leave food crumbs or dirty dishes overnight.
  • Eliminate moisture – Remove standing water, fix leaking pipes, and keep bathrooms, kitchens, and utility areas dry.
  • Seal entry points – Close gaps, cracks, doors, and vents to prevent cockroaches from entering.
  • Properly store food – Keep food in airtight containers and avoid leaving uncovered leftovers or pet food out for long periods.
  • Clean garbage daily – Dispose of household waste regularly. Use bins that come with tight-fitted lids.
  • Reduce clutter – Remove newspapers and cardboard boxes, which make great hiding places.
  • Deep clean regularly – Deep clean behind the appliances, furniture and cabinets to eliminate grease buildup and food debris.
  • Schedule professional pest control – Book regular inspections and preventive treatments, especially in apartments, commercial properties and restaurants. Professional pest control assists in detecting early signs of infestation, and targets hidden areas of breeding before the problem turns severe.

Professional cockroach treatment in Dubai

Professional cockroach treatment is the most effective and efficient solution for established infestations. Instead of targeting only visible cockroaches, pest control experts identify breeding and nesting areas to achieve long-term control.

Here are some treatment solutions:

  • Inspection – Technicians inspect the property to identify hiding spots, infestation levels, and entry points.
  • Identification – Cockroach species are identified to determine the most suitable treatment method.
  • Targeted gel treatment – Gel baits are applied in strategic locations where cockroaches hide and feed, allowing the treatment to spread through the colony.
  • Residual spray – Residual insecticides are applied to high-risk areas to create a protective barrier that continues working after application.
  • Crevice and crack treatment – Hidden spaces behind appliances, cabinets, plumbing lines, and wall gaps are treated to eliminate cockroaches where they breed and live.
  • Monitoring – Follow-up inspections help in assessing treatment effectiveness and detecting any remaining activity.
  • Follow-up visits – Additional treatments might be recommended for serious infestations or for preventing recurrence.

Professional cockroach treatment focuses on hidden sites and colonies and not just the visible cockroaches. The approach helps in breaking the breeding cycle and offering more effective and long-lasting control.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why do cockroaches re-appear after treatment? 

It is quite normal to see the reappearance of some cockroaches for a few days after a treatment is done and they come in contact with the products. Activity must gradually decrease as treatment takes full effect.

How long do cockroach treatments last? 

The effectiveness of treatment depends on the method used and infestation level, but professional treatments typically offer protection for several months to weeks. Regular maintenance helps in preventing reinfestation.

Is cockroach treatment safe for pets and children? 

Professional pest control treatments are considered safe when applied according to the manufacturer’s guidelines. Follow the instructions provided by technicians regarding any necessary precautions and re-entry.

Can cockroaches re-appear after treatment? 

Yes, cockroaches come back when water, food, and entry points remain accessible, or the neighboring infestation spreads rapidly. Preventive pest control and good sanitation reduce chances of recurrence.
